Abstract
An object-oriented (OO) expert system for the operation and the management of power system protective relay is described in this paper. The characteristics of the OO method and the expert systems used in power systems are analyzed at first to show why the OO method is used. Then, the principles of designing and implementing OO method based expert systems for power systems are presented. Following these principles, an object-oriented expert system for power system protective relay operation and management (OOPRES) was developed in a PC/Windows environment with the Borland C++ for windows. It is shown by the OOPRES that the OO method is efficient and flexible for knowledge acquisition, knowledge management and reasoning
